> > SCHED_DEADLINE servers can help fixing starvation issues of low priority tasks (e.g., 
> > SCHED_OTHER) when higher priority tasks monopolize CPU cycles. Today we have RT 
> > Throttling; DEADLINE servers should be able to replace and improve that.
> 
> It would be worth noting what "server" is in this context.

It comes from Constant Bandwidth Server (CBS), that SCHED_DEADLINE is
implementing [1].
